Table Of Contents

List of Illustrations vii
Acknowledgments xiii
Introduction xv


PART ONE: FOUNDATIONS FOR SOCIAL ORDER 1
1. The Puritan Way of Life 3

PART TWO: STRUCTURES OF AMERICAN NATIONALISM 19
2. Row Upon Row in the Commercial City 24 
3. The “Big House” and the Slave Quarters 41
4. Housing Factory Workers 58 
5. Independence and the Rural Cottage 73

PART THREE: ACCOMMODATIONS FOR AN INDUSTRIAL SOCIETY 91
6. Victorian Suburbs and the Cult of Domesticity 96
7. Americanization and Ethnicity in Urban Tenements 114
8. The Advantages of Apartment Life 135

PART FOUR: DOMESTICATION OF MODERN LIVING 153
9. The Progressive Housewife and the Bungalow 158
10. Welfare Capitalism and the Company Town 177
11. Planned Residential Communities 193

PART FIVE: GOVERNMENT STANDARDS FOR AMERICAN FAMILIES 215
12. Public Housing for the Worthy Poor 220
13. The New Suburban Expansion and the American Dream 240
14. Preserving Homes and Promoting Change 262

Notes 285
Further Reading 302
Index 319
